India's first-ever web series on Adi Shankaracharya is gearing up for its highly anticipated release, marking a significant milestone in digital content. Presented by The Art of Living and Sri Sri Publication Trust, the series is produced by ONM Multimedia and written and directed by Onkar Nath Mishra. This groundbreaking project will offer a cinematic portrayal of the life and contributions of Shri Aadi Shankaracharya, who reestablished Sanatan Dharma and united India in the 8th century.


The first season, consisting of 10 episodes, focuses on the early life of Shri Aadi Shankaracharya. Filmed across stunning locations in India, the series showcases elaborate sets, state-of-the-art VFX, and a compelling narrative. It promises to engage audiences with its detailed recreations, grand visuals, and impactful performances. Season 1 centers on his childhood, depicting how an eight-year-old boy, born in turbulent times, renounced worldly life and embarked on a journey that would eventually unite India politically, spiritually, and culturally.


The show features a talented ensemble cast, with Arnav Khanijo portraying the young Shankaracharya, alongside veterans like Gagan Malik, Sandip Mohan, and Yogesh Mahajan. Mishra also expressed his excitement about the second season, which delves deeper into Shri Aadi Shankaracharya’s later life, and has already completed filming. Manish Wadhwa, known for his role as the antagonist in 'Gadar 2', portrays Aadi Shankaracharya’s Guru in season 2.
